About Laharum
Laharum is a small rural locality in western Victoria, situated within the Rural City of Horsham local government area approximately 291 kilometres west-north-west of Melbourne and 33 kilometres south-east of Horsham. Covering an expansive 219 square kilometres of Wimmera farming country, the locality has a population of around 162 residents and a predominantly agricultural character. It lies in the shadow of the Grampians (Gariwerd) National Park, giving the area a striking backdrop of rugged mountain ranges rising from the flat Wimmera plains.
The Wimmera region surrounding Laharum is one of Victoria's most significant dryland farming areas, with wheat, wool, and canola production dominating the landscape. Residents access most services, shopping, and schooling in Horsham — the regional centre — which offers supermarkets, hospitals, schools, and a vibrant regional lifestyle. The proximity to the Grampians National Park means Laharum residents have remarkable access to walking trails, waterfalls, wildlife, and scenic lookouts, making it an appealing base for those who love the outdoors and wide open country.
